Film Lineup:
1:00 pm Leaving Paradise
Director: Ofer Frieman
Cleo fulfilled his dream: to leave the big city with his wife and fifteen children, to establish a family commune on a farm in Brazil. Exploring their family-roots leads the children to discover their surprising heritage, which undermines the existence of the communal paradise.
3:30 pm For the Living
Director: Marc Bennett & Tim Roper
Ten-year-old Holocaust survivor Marcel Zielinski's 60-mile journey from Auschwitz to Krakow in 1945. In 2019, cyclists retraced his path in "Ride for the Living," reflecting on humanity's capacity for dehumanization and empathy.
7:00 pm Blind at Heart
Director: Barbara Albert
After WWII, Helene is ready to do anything to start a new life. As a young woman, she came to the exciting Berlin of the roaring 20s, wanting to become a doctor, and soon fell in love with a man named Karl. But the course of her life took a drastic, irreversible turn when the Nazis came into power.
